Halliday raises $20 million to build AI agents that operate safely on blockchain

  • Halliday has raised $20 million in Series A funding to develop AI agents that can safely operate on blockchain networks.
  • The funding round, led by Andreessen Horowitz’s crypto arm (a16z crypto), brings the company’s total funding to over $26 million.
  • Halliday's core innovation, the Agentic Workflow Protocol (AWP), creates 'immutable guardrails' for AI agents operating on blockchain networks.
  • The protocol ensures that autonomous systems can execute tasks within defined parameters without the risk of exploits or unintended actions.
